Novelties in Flower Seeds G WEEBER & DON DIANTHUS Laeiniaius Mirabilis (Single Fringed Japan Pinks) This new- strain of animal pinks grows fcom 12 In 15 inches in height, with very narrow foliage, and produces large flowers of about 3 to 4- inches in diameter. The petals of the flowers are deeply cut, turned and twisted in all directions, making excellent material for bouquets. Finest mixed. Pkt. 25c. ESCHSCHOLTZIA Carmine King The beautiful carmine rose color of the flowers makes this new variety a very valuable addition lo the now- existing collection of liscbseholtzius, Pkt. 25c. Ever-Blooming Hollyhocks A Grand Combination Mixture Doubles, semi-doubles and singles, including all colors, shades and variegations. Flower the first season from seed. Sown middle or end of March and put out at the beginning of May, the plants bloom in the second half of July, about a week later than the biennial race. The flowers are just as large as ordinary Hollyhocks and all the well-known colors'are represented, Pkt. loo MIGNONETTE New York Market W. £»0.'s Extra Choice Strain, Indoubtedly this is the grandest variety of Miunonctte at the present time. Its individual florets are oi large size, form a graceful as well as compact spike, and possess a delicious fragrance. Pkt. 50c., 14 oz. $ -. NASTURTIUM, (1IANT PL0WEHIN0 LARKSPUR Newport scarlet Can be treated either as an annual or biennial. Seed should be sown as soon as the ground can be worked, for early flowering in July. As it does not stand trans- planting well, the seed should be sown where the plants are intended to flower.
